Commercial License and Business Use

A critical note for small business owners using this for commercial design: always check the license that comes with the digital product. This asset is designed for commercial use, but terms can vary. You must confirm that the license covers physical product sales, such as t-shirts, packaged food, or handmade goods. Respecting the creator’s license is part of professional branding and ensures you can use the asset confidently in your client work or for your own business. It is a small step that protects your business and supports the creative marketplace.
